Overview

Under limited supervision, we provide loss prevention consulting services within the Property and Marine Loss Prevention department, specializing in equipment breakdown risk. Completes Boiler and Pressure Vessel inspection, conducts extensive research, data collection, evaluation, and analysis to make recommendations that help control customers’ sources of risk, loss, and costs. Serves as a technical expert in mechanical systems and equipment breakdown exposures.

This position may be filled at various levels, commensurate with the candidate’s qualifications and possession of an NBIC Commission. The role involves a hybrid work arrangement, combining remote responsibilities with field-based activities. The Risk Control team operates in a collaborative environment, working virtually across multiple target territories to support operational objectives. The selected candidate will be expected to work in the field a minimum of three days per week and must be willing to travel throughout Texas and Oklahoma to support project needs across the region.

Responsibilities
  • Conduct on-site inspections of boilers, pressure vessels, and mechanical systems to identify hazards and assess risk.
  • Compile facts from site visits, reports, and databases to evaluate existing processes, determine severity/frequency of issues, and identify improvement needs.
  • Assess and benchmark customer performance against internal and industry standards, including NBIC requirements.
  • Interpret and analyze data to determine best course of action and solutions that satisfy customer risk service needs.
  • Utilize advanced software applications and Microsoft systems to develop innovative, cost-effective solutions.
  • Investigate cause-and-effect relationships and prepare technical reports summarizing findings and recommendations.
  • Organize data into clear, actionable formats and present reports outlining improvement plans and cultural/behavioral changes.
  • Maintain effective partnerships with customers, learning their business to identify risk management objectives and needs.
  • Provide technical support and training to assist with implementation of recommendations and action plans.
  • Actively pursue professional development to better meet customer expectations.
  • May participate in acquiring new business by following up on leads and presenting proposals.
Qualifications
  • Education: Bachelor’s degree in engineering or related field preferred.
  • Experience: Strong background in mechanical systems or loss control engineering.
  • Certifications: NBIC Commission required for posted position, but trainee opportunities available; other relevant certifications a plus.
